Output 3d361899e8aee0466ee25f32c536e0a0eb94e114a8212d2348ac0ca2a90d8b51:0

value
5685080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76b11089f4202551dce9bf69d0829a822394084 OP_EQUAL
address
3ML3TuCQHqXtR1R2aw6iVFCba7wG6o5Sqi
transaction
3d361899e8aee0466ee25f32c536e0a0eb94e114a8212d2348ac0ca2a90d8b51
confirmations
294947
spent
true